Orange Grove offers singe family homes near Gulfport's amenities

The community of Orange Grove, located north of Gulfport’s beaches, has plenty of single-family homes with access to shopping, dining and various attractions. Buyers have multiple housing styles and subdivisions to pick from, but properties are primarily close together with smaller lots. Oak and magnolia trees can be typical lawn decorations. Orange Grove is also within commuting distance to job centers such as the Naval Construction Battalion Center. “It's considered north Gulfport, basically that is where everyone is trying to be at, and [it's] mostly military personnel trying to be close to the Seabee base,” says Carl Watson, a Realtor with Busch Realty Group, who sells in the community.

A wide variety of single-family homes with an HOA presence

Ranch styles, bungalows and cottages can range from $100,000 to $350,000, while New Traditions, Greek Revivals and Italianates cost anywhere from $380,000 to $750,000. Prices depend on factors such as age, location and condition. Townhomes are also available. Homeowner’s associations do oversee some properties.
Watson says the community has attracted a mix of retirees, families and workers. This includes members of the military and health care industry. Singing River Gulfport Hospital is in the neighborhood on Community Road. According to Federal Emergency Management Agency maps, the community is at risk of flooding, especially near local creeks. Hurricanes and severe storms are also factors. A train line runs along the western end of Orange Grove, causing noise.

Orange Grove students zoned for multiple public schools

Students are zoned for multiple public schools, including Bel Aire Elementary or Crossroads Elementary, both graded B on Niche. Harrison Central Elementary has a B-minus. They can continue to B-rated North Gulfport Middle School or West Harrison Middle, which earns an A. Pupils can finish at Harrison Central High School, graded B or A-ranked West Harrison High. Both schools offer technical education in the health science and construction industries.

Easy highway and interstate access

The community does not have any public transport links and is primarily car dependent. The entrance to Interstate 10 is on the southern end of Orange Grove on U.S. Highway 49. Gulfport’s Amtrak station will reopen in August, providing rail service to Mobile, Alabama, and New Orleans. Gulfport-Biloxi International Airport is 5 miles south.

Multiple green spaces to enjoy with coastal fun just south of the area

The 40-acre Goldin Sports Complex features multiple baseball and softball diamonds, sports courts, and football fields. Clarence Johnson Memorial Park also has baseball fields, a splash pad and walking paths. The Orange Grove Community Center features a rentable hall and a playground. The Gulf Islands Waterpark, west of the neighborhood, has multiple rides and waterslides, but only opens during Summer. Bayou Vista Golf Course, south of Orange Grove, is open to the public and has a 5,900-yard, Par 71 layout. Beachside attractions and adult entertainment at the Island View Casino are 7 miles south.

Multiple eateries and shopping locations line U.S. 49

Restaurants are concentrated along U.S. 49 and include multiple chains and independent spots. Sicily’s Pizza serves soups, salads and pasta dishes. The Pour House has burgers, wings and bar games like pool and darts. Siam Thai Cuisine has authentic soups, curries and noodle dishes.
Shopping locations are also on U.S. 49. Retail and department stores, including Belk and Bealls, are at the Crossroads Center near the entrance to I-10. Grocery and big-box stores include Sam’s Club, Walmart Neighborhood Market and Food Giant.
